303100010110 has 16 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 545587333200. Its totient is φ = 121238378496.
The previous prime is 303100010089. The next prime is 303100010159. The reversal of 303100010110 is 11010001303.
It is a super-2 number, since 2×3031000101102 (a number of 24 digits) contains 22 as substring.
It is a Harshad number since it is a multiple of its sum of digits (10).
It is a congruent number.
It is an unprimeable number.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 7 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 830206 + ... + 1138174.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(34099208325).
Almost surely, 2303100010110 is an apocalyptic number.
303100010110 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(242487323090).
303100010110 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
303100010110 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 406395.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 9, while the sum is 10.
Adding to 303100010110 its reverse (11010001303), we get a palindrome (314110011413).
The spelling of 303100010110 in words is "three hundred three billion, one hundred million, ten thousand, one hundred ten".
